SERVICING
For servicing the FW-R33 and FW-R55 the set has to be divided into two parts:
1. Except for the CD-R/W module all workshops can repair the set on component level.
2. The CD-R/W module can only be repaired on component level with the help of ComPair.
With this tool diagnosing of the set can be done in an interactive way. In the tool also the adjustment procedure has been
implemented. The adjustment is absolutely necessary in case the CDR Main Board and/or CD drive (CDR Loader) is
disconnected from the matched production combination.
Only designated workshops can perform these repairs!
Please send the complete set to the designated workshop.

  • Page 43 BRIEF INTRODUCTION OF THE AF9 BOARD The AF9 Board consists of the following features : a. TDA7468D IC TDA7468D IC (7501) which includes functions such as source selection, loudness control, dynamic bass control, treble control, volume control and muting function. Sound features such as ALC, DBB, DSC and IS are controllable via I C Bus from the microprocessor.
